Throughout history, many civilizations have employed amulets as protective and empowering symbols. From ancient Egypt’s scarab beetles, believed to bring good fortune, to China’s use of jade and coins for prosperity, the quest for wealth has often been intertwined with spiritual beliefs.
In many cultures, specific symbols and materials are associated with wealth attraction. For instance, in Indian tradition, the Lakshmi coin represents the goddess of wealth and prosperity, while in Feng Shui, certain objects like the wealth vase or money frog are considered powerful enhancers of financial luck. Understanding these cultural contexts can deepen your connection to the amulet you choose.

With countless options available, here is a list of some widely recognized amulets known for their association with attracting wealth:
Chinese coins are often tied together with red string and displayed in homes or carried in wallets as they symbolize prosperity according to Feng Shui principles. The circular shape represents eternity and wholeness, reinforcing the idea that wealth is continuous.
The Money Frog is a popular Feng Shui symbol that represents windfall fortune. Traditionally depicted sitting on piles of coins with a gold coin in its mouth, this creature is often placed near entrances or cash registers to attract financial blessings.
Often called the “Merchant’s Stone,” citrine is believed to manifest abundance and success. Carrying a piece of citrine or placing it in your workspace is thought to enhance motivation and creativity in money-making endeavors.
As mentioned earlier, this coin is dedicated to Goddess Lakshmi in Hinduism and symbolizes wealth and prosperity. It is often kept in homes or businesses as a form of spiritual investment.
The pentacle is a five-pointed star encased within a circle and is commonly used in Wiccan traditions as a symbol of protection and balance. When specifically fashioned for prosperity purposes, it serves as an empowering talisman aimed at financial success.
